Skip to content

Indoor & Outdoor Hobbies for Kids | 2025

This blog explores the importance of hobbies for kids, different types of hobbies, how to choose the right one, and ways to encourage hobbies within the family.

Hobbies play a crucial role in a child's development, helping them build creativity, confidence, and life skills. Whether it's painting, sports, or science experiments, the right hobby can nurture a child's passion and curiosity. In this guide, we explore the best hobbies for different age groups, including hobbies for girls, family hobby ideas, and unique hobbies to learn.

Glossary : 

Hobbies - Hobbies are activities done for enjoyment and relaxation in one’s free time, helping individuals develop new skills and interests.

Why Hobbies are Important for Kids

A well-chosen hobby offers more than just fun—it helps kids develop essential life skills such as patience, problem-solving, and teamwork. Here are some key benefits of hobbies for children:

  • Boost Creativity – Artistic and craft hobbies encourage self-expression.

  • Enhance Physical Health – Sports and outdoor activities keep kids active.

  • Improve Focus & Discipline – Learning an instrument or coding builds patience.

  • Encourage Social Interaction – Team hobbies help kids make friends and improve communication.

Safehugs kids wear

Fun and Exciting Hobbies for Kids

Before choosing a hobby, consider your child's interests, personality, and age. Below, we’ve categorized hobbies based on interests to help you find the perfect one for your child.

Creative and Artistic Hobbies

For kids who love creativity, artistic hobbies offer an amazing outlet.

Hobbies for Kids
  1. Drawing, Painting & Coloring – These activities enhance creativity and improve fine motor skills. They allow kids to express their thoughts, emotions, and imagination visually.

  2. Craft and DIY Projects – From making jewelry to origami, crafting helps kids develop patience and problem-solving skills. It fosters creativity while giving them a sense of accomplishment.

  3. Crochet Hobbies – Learning crochet improves hand-eye coordination and concentration. This skill is not only fun but also allows kids to create their own accessories and gifts.

  4. Performing Arts – Singing, dancing, and acting help kids build confidence and overcome stage fear. They also encourage self-expression and improve communication skills.

  5. Musical Hobbies – Playing an instrument strengthens memory, focus, and coordination. It also enhances emotional well-being and introduces kids to the joy of music.

  6. Storytelling and Creative Writing – Writing stories, poems, or scripts boosts imagination and language skills. It helps kids express their ideas and emotions in a unique way.

  7. Photography and Scrapbooking – Capturing moments through photography and preserving them in scrapbooks encourages creativity and storytelling. It also improves observation skills and attention to detail.

Science and Educational Hobbies

If your child is curious about the world, science hobbies can be both fun and educational.

Hobbies for Kids
  1. Sports & Athletics – Engaging in sports like soccer, basketball, or running builds strength and endurance. It also teaches teamwork, discipline, and perseverance.

  2. Cycling & Skating – These activities improve balance, coordination, and confidence. They offer a fun way for kids to explore their surroundings while staying active.

  3. Hiking & Nature Exploration – Encourages curiosity and appreciation for nature. Kids develop problem-solving skills and physical endurance through outdoor adventures.

  4. Martial Arts – Builds discipline, self-defense skills, and confidence. It also enhances focus, agility, and respect for others.

  5. Swimming – A life-saving skill that strengthens muscles and boosts lung capacity. It’s a refreshing way to stay fit while improving coordination and endurance.

  6. STEM Experiments & Robotics – Hands-on experiments and robotics projects help kids understand scientific concepts in a fun way. These activities improve problem-solving and critical thinking skills.

  7. Astronomy & Stargazing – Learning about planets, stars, and constellations sparks curiosity about the universe. Kids develop patience and observation skills while exploring the wonders of space.

Glossary : 

STEM - It stands for Science, Technology, Engineering, and Mathematics, focusing on hands-on learning and problem-solving skills in these fields.

Mom Insider whatsapp group

Nature and Outdoor Hobbies

Outdoor hobbies help kids connect with nature and stay active.

Hobbies for Kids
    1. Gardening and Plant Care – Teaches kids patience and responsibility as they nurture plants. It also helps them understand the importance of nature and sustainability.

    2. Hiking and Birdwatching – Encourages curiosity and observation skills while exploring the outdoors. A perfect way for families to bond and appreciate wildlife together.

    3. Outdoor Games and Adventures – Activities like treasure hunts, camping, and obstacle courses boost problem-solving skills and teamwork. They make outdoor play exciting and memorable.

    4. Fishing and Nature Photography – Helps kids develop patience and appreciation for wildlife. Capturing nature through photography enhances creativity and observation skills.

    5. Rock Collecting and Fossil Hunting – Encourages exploration and scientific curiosity. Kids can learn about geology while discovering unique rocks and fossils.

    6. Kayaking and Canoeing – Builds strength, coordination, and water safety skills. These activities allow kids to experience the thrill of adventure while exploring rivers and lakes.

    7. Farming and Beekeeping – A hands-on way to learn about agriculture and the environment. Kids gain knowledge about food sources and the importance of pollinators in nature.

Athletic and Physical Hobbies

For kids who love movement, sports and physical hobbies are ideal.

Hobbies for Kids
    1. Soccer, Basketball, Swimming, Gymnastics – These sports enhance teamwork, discipline, and coordination. They also improve endurance and overall fitness.

    2. Martial Arts and Yoga – Martial arts teach self-defense, focus, and respect, while yoga promotes flexibility, mindfulness, and inner strength.

    3. Skating and Cycling – Fun activities that improve balance, coordination, and confidence. They also encourage outdoor play and independence.

    4. Hobbies That Get Kids Moving – Dance, jump rope, and obstacle courses keep kids active and energized. These activities boost agility, endurance, and creativity.

    5. Track and Field – Sprinting, long jump, and relay races help build speed, strength, and endurance. They also teach kids goal-setting and perseverance.

    6. Rock Climbing and Parkour – These activities develop strength, problem-solving skills, and courage. They encourage kids to challenge themselves physically in a fun way.

    7. Trampoline and Aerial Arts – Activities like trampoline jumping and aerial silks enhance coordination, core strength, and body awareness while making fitness enjoyable.

Collecting Hobbies

Collecting helps kids develop patience and organization skills.

Hobbies for Kids
    1. Stamp and Coin Collecting – A classic hobby that introduces kids to history and world cultures. It helps develop curiosity and research skills.

    2. Rock and Shell Collecting – Perfect for young explorers who love nature. It encourages observation, classification, and appreciation for Earth's treasures.

    3. Book and Card Collecting – Fosters a love for reading and storytelling. Collecting trading cards also enhances memory, strategy, and social interaction.

    4. Toy and Action Figure Collecting – A fun way for kids to engage with their favorite characters. It also teaches organization and the value of preserving collectibles.

    5. Sticker and Stationery Collecting – Encourages creativity and self-expression. Kids enjoy trading and designing with their collections.

    6. Pressed Flowers and Leaves Collection – A great way to appreciate nature and learn about different plant species. It also introduces kids to simple botanical preservation techniques.

    7. Autograph and Memorabilia Collecting – Helps kids build connections to their favorite athletes, artists, or role models. It inspires them to learn more about influential figures.

Tech and Digital Hobbies

Technology can be an exciting way for kids to learn and explore creativity.

Hobbies for Kids
    1. Learning to Code and App Development – Encourages logical thinking and problem-solving. Kids can create games, websites, or apps while improving their analytical skills.

    2. Photography and Video Editing – Helps kids develop an eye for detail and storytelling. Enhancing digital skills, it allows them to capture and edit moments creatively.

    3. Gaming and Animation – When done in moderation, gaming can improve strategy, reflexes, and teamwork. Animation fosters creativity and introduces kids to digital design.

    4. Robotics and Engineering Kits – Engages kids in hands-on STEM learning by allowing them to build and program robots. It enhances critical thinking and innovation.

    5. Digital Art and Graphic Design – Encourages artistic expression using technology. Kids can create illustrations, comics, and designs while learning professional software skills.

    6. Blogging and Content Creation – Helps kids develop writing and communication skills by sharing their interests online. It fosters creativity, research, and self-expression.

    7. Virtual Reality (VR) and Augmented Reality (AR) Exploration – Introduces kids to immersive technology, enhancing their understanding of 3D spaces, storytelling, and innovation.

Culinary and DIY Hobbies

For kids who love food and hands-on activities, these hobbies are perfect!

Hobbies for Kids
    1. Cooking and Baking – A fun way to explore math, chemistry, and nutrition. Kids learn patience, measurement, and the joy of creating delicious treats.

    2. DIY Home Projects – Making decorations, furniture, or crafts fosters creativity and hands-on skills. It teaches kids problem-solving and the satisfaction of building something themselves.

    3. Handmade Crafts – Creating personalized gifts and DIY projects boosts imagination and fine motor skills. It’s a great way for kids to express themselves through art.

    4. Soap and Candle Making – A fun, hands-on activity that teaches kids about science and creativity. They can experiment with colors, scents, and shapes while making useful products.

    5. Sewing and Embroidery – Helps kids develop patience, precision, and hand-eye coordination. They can design their own clothes, accessories, or home décor items.

    6. Upcycling and Recycling Crafts – Encourages sustainability by turning old materials into creative new items. This hobby fosters environmental awareness and resourcefulness.

    7. Jewelry Making – A great way for kids to design unique accessories while improving their dexterity. It allows them to experiment with different materials, colors, and styles.

Animal and Pet-Related Hobbies

If your child loves animals, these hobbies can be both fun and educational.

Hobbies for Kids
    1. Learning About Different Animals – Exploring books, videos, and documentaries helps kids understand wildlife, habitats, and conservation. It nurtures curiosity and a love for nature.

    2. Pet Care and Training – Taking care of pets teaches responsibility, empathy, and patience. Training pets also strengthens the bond between kids and their furry friends.

    3. Volunteering at Animal Shelters – A meaningful way to help animals in need while learning about kindness and commitment. It builds a sense of social responsibility and teamwork.

    4. Wildlife Photography – Encourages kids to observe and capture animals in their natural habitat. It improves patience, focus, and appreciation for biodiversity.

    5. Horseback Riding – Develops confidence, coordination, and balance while fostering a deep connection with animals. It also teaches discipline and responsibility.

    6. Beekeeping – A unique hobby that introduces kids to the importance of pollinators. It teaches patience, environmental awareness, and the basics of honey production.

    7. Creating a Backyard Habitat – Setting up bird feeders, butterfly gardens, or small ponds helps kids understand ecosystems. It encourages them to take care of nature and observe local wildlife.
Mom Insider Whatsapp Group

Other Unique and Rare Hobbies

Looking for something different? Try these rare hobbies for kids!

Hobbies for Kids
    1. Origami and Paper Crafts – Folding intricate paper designs improves concentration, patience, and fine motor skills. It’s a fun way to explore hands-on creativity.

    2. Calligraphy and Hand Lettering – Develops precision, patience, and artistic flair. Kids can create beautiful writing styles while improving focus and hand control.

    3. Puzzle-Solving and Brain Games – Engaging in puzzles, riddles, and strategy games sharpens problem-solving skills. It enhances memory, logic, and critical thinking in a fun way.

    4. Lego Building and Model Making – Encourages creativity, spatial awareness, and engineering skills. Kids can design and build their own structures, boosting imagination and problem-solving abilities.

    5. Journaling and Creative Writing – Helps kids express their thoughts, emotions, and ideas through storytelling. It enhances vocabulary, creativity, and communication skills.

    6. Meteorology and Stargazing – Observing the sky and learning about weather patterns sparks curiosity in science. It encourages exploration of astronomy and environmental studies.

    7. Foraging and Nature Crafting – Teaches kids about edible plants, natural dyes, and eco-friendly crafting. It fosters a deeper connection with nature and resourcefulness.

How to the Choose the Best Hobby for Your Child

With so many options, how do you pick the right hobby?

Hobbies for Kids
    1. Observe Their Interests – Pay attention to what naturally catches your child's attention. Do they enjoy music, drawing, building things, or playing outside? Their daily activities can provide hints about hobbies they might enjoy and excel at.

    2. Match Their Personality – Consider whether your child is more of an introvert or extrovert. Introverted children may enjoy activities like reading, painting, or puzzles, while extroverted kids may thrive in team sports, dance, or drama. Matching the hobby to their personality ensures they feel comfortable and engaged.

    3. Try Different Activities – Expose them to a variety of hobbies before they choose one. Let them experiment with music, sports, storytelling, or even STEM-related hobbies like coding or robotics. Trial classes, hobby kits, and community workshops can help them explore new interests.

    4. Keep It Fun & Flexible – A hobby should be enjoyable, not feel like a chore. If they lose interest in one, let them explore another without pressure. Encouraging flexibility helps them discover what truly excites them without fear of failure.

    5. Balance Screen & Physical Activities – If they love digital hobbies like gaming or coding, balance them with outdoor or hands-on activities like cycling, gardening, or crafts. This ensures they develop a well-rounded set of skills while staying active and engaged.

Fun Family Hobby Ideas

Hobbies aren’t just for kids—families can enjoy them together too!

Hobbies for Kids
    1. Board Games and Puzzle Nights – A great way to strengthen family bonds while improving strategy and teamwork. It’s a fun alternative to screen time.

    2. Gardening as a Family – Teaches responsibility, patience, and teamwork while enjoying nature. Growing plants together fosters a sense of accomplishment.

    3. DIY Projects and Home Decor – Crafting and decorating together allow families to express creativity. It’s a hands-on way to personalize living spaces.

    4. Cooking Together – Experimenting with new recipes helps kids learn basic cooking skills. It’s a fun and delicious way to spend quality time as a family.

    5. Outdoor Adventures – Hiking, biking, or even simple nature walks encourage physical activity and exploration. It’s a great way to connect with nature and each other.

    6. Family Book Club – Reading the same book and discussing it together promotes literacy and deepens family connections. It’s a relaxing and educational bonding activity.

    7. Music and Dance Sessions – Whether learning an instrument, singing, or having fun dance-offs, music brings joy and energy to family time while fostering creativity.
Safehugs Kids Wear

Tips for Encouraging Hobbies in Kids

Helping kids develop hobbies fosters creativity, confidence, and lifelong skills.

    1. Make hobbies a family activity – Engaging together keeps kids motivated and strengthens family bonds. Shared experiences make learning more enjoyable.

    2. Set up a hobby-friendly space – Having a dedicated area for crafts, music, or reading encourages kids to explore their interests freely.

    3. Let kids explore different hobbies – Exposing them to various activities helps them discover their passions before committing to one.

    4. Encourage them without pressure – Hobbies should be fun and stress-free. Support their interests without forcing expectations.

Hobbies are a fantastic way for kids to explore their passions, develop new skills, and stay active. Whether it’s artistic hobbies, science hobbies, sports, or unique hobbies to learn, there’s something for every child. Encourage your kids to try different activities, and most importantly, let them have fun!

Related:

Read more

From Home to Preschool: A Parent’s Guide

From Home to Preschool: A Parent’s Guide

Starting preschool is a big step for both you and your child. While it’s exciting, it can also bring some anxiety, but with the right preparation, the transition can be smooth. Preschools like KLAY...

Read more
'oa' Words for Kids with Pictures & Worksheets

'oa' Words for Kids with Pictures & Worksheets

Are you looking for an engaging way to teach your child "oa" words? Our blog is the perfect resource! The "oa" vowel team, found in words like boat, coat, and soap, helps kids improve phonics, spel...

Read more